Amoi M300 specs.

Design Amoi M300
Device type:
Feature phone
Form factor:
Candybar
Dimensions:
4.09 x 1.81 x 0.51 inches (104.0 x 46.0 x 12.9 mm)
Weight:
2.82 oz (80 g)
the average is 4.8 oz (137 g)
Design features:
Numeric keypad, Soft keys (2), D-Pad
Display Amoi M300
Physical size:
2.0 inches
Screen Resolution:?Screen resolution refers to the size of the image received on the screen in pixels
144 x 176 pixels
Pixel density:
114 ppi
Technology:
TFT
Screen-to-body ratio:
26.48 %
Colors:
65 536
Camera Amoi M300
Camera:
0.3 megapixels VGA
Camcorder:
Yes
Hardware Amoi M300
Built-in storage:
0.045 GB
Storage expansion:
microSD
Multimedia Amoi M300
Music player Supported formats:
MP3
Video playback Supported formats:
MPEG4
Radio:
FM
Speakers:
Earpiece, Loudspeaker
Internet browsing Amoi M300
Browser supports:
WAP 2.0
Technology Amoi M300
GSM:
900, 1800 MHz
Data:
GPRS
Phone features Amoi M300
Messaging:
SMS, MMS
Other features Amoi M300
Notifications:
Music ringtones (MP3), Polyphonic ringtones (64 voices)
